NFS Heat is an offline-focused game with online multiplayer components (PvP races and the Heat Studio). Unlike Need for Speed Unbound or FIFA , EA's anti-cheat (EAAC) is extremely relaxed for Heat.
Nfs Heat Save Editor is a third-party tool designed to edit and modify the save files of Need for Speed: Heat. Developed by a team of passionate gamers and programmers, this editor allows players to tweak and customize various aspects of their game, unlocking new possibilities and extending the game's replay value. With Nfs Heat Save Editor, players can modify their save files to acquire new cars, upgrade their existing vehicles, and even alter their in-game stats. Nfs Heat Save Editor

It is important to distinguish a Save Editor from a Mod Manager (Frosty). A save editor modifies your progression file. A mod manager changes game assets (graphics, physics). You do not need Frosty to use a save editor, though many players use both. If you’ve been grinding Palm City for months
